What to Consider for a Fall Wedding Outfit

Before selecting your outfit, it’s important to consider the details of the event. Fall weddings can vary widely in formality and setting, from outdoor ceremonies surrounded by foliage to elegant evening celebrations indoors.

The venue and dress code should guide your choice. A formal wedding may call for a floor-length gown, while a more relaxed setting allows for midi dresses or softer silhouettes.

The time of day also plays a role. Daytime weddings often suit lighter fabrics and softer styling, while evening events typically lean toward more structured silhouettes and elevated details.

Best Colors for Fall Wedding Guest Dresses

Fall fashion is defined by its rich and inviting color palette. Jewel tones and earthy hues feel especially appropriate for the season, reflecting the natural surroundings.

Popular fall wedding colors include:

  • Emerald green
  • Burgundy and wine tones
  • Navy and deep blue
  • Warm metallics
  • Deep floral prints

These shades create a sense of warmth and sophistication, making them ideal for both daytime and evening celebrations.

What Shoes to Wear to a Fall Wedding

Shoes should complement both your dress and the venue. For outdoor weddings, block heels or closed-toe shoes can provide more stability on grass or uneven surfaces.

For indoor or formal events, classic heels or elegant pumps are always a reliable choice. Darker tones and textured finishes often pair well with fall color palettes.

Comfort is also important, especially for longer celebrations that include dancing and standing.

How to Dress for Cooler Weather

Fall weather can shift throughout the day, making layering an important part of your outfit. Even if the ceremony takes place in the afternoon, evenings often become cooler.

A lightweight wrap, shawl, or tailored outer layer can help you stay comfortable while maintaining a polished look. Choosing layers that complement your dress ensures your outfit remains cohesive from day to night.

Fall Wedding Guest FAQs

Can You Wear Floral Dresses to a Fall Wedding?

Yes. Floral dresses with deeper tones or autumn-inspired patterns work beautifully for fall weddings.

Are Dark Colors Appropriate for Fall Weddings?

Absolutely. Darker hues are a hallmark of fall fashion and are widely considered appropriate for wedding guest attire.

Do You Need a Long Dress for a Fall Wedding?

Not always. While formal weddings may call for gowns, midi dresses and shorter styles can be appropriate depending on the dress code.

What Should You Avoid Wearing?

Avoid overly casual fabrics or styles that feel out of place for the level of formality. As with any wedding, white or bridal tones should be avoided.
